What is the Mutual Insurance Agent CPO Electronic Money Transfer Form?

The Mutual Insurance Agent CPO Electronic Money Transfer Form is a crucial document that facilitates electronic money transfers for billing payments in the mutual insurance sector. This form is integral for insurance agents as it streamlines the payment process, enhancing efficiency. It is essential to submit this form before 2:45 P.M. Central Time for same-day posting, ensuring timely processing of transactions.

How to Fill Out the Mutual Insurance Agent CPO Electronic Money Transfer Form Online (Step-by-Step)

Filling out the Mutual Insurance Agent CPO Electronic Money Transfer Form online is straightforward. Follow these steps for accurate completion:
  • Enter the agency name in the designated field.
  • Input the agency code to identify your institution.
  • Choose the date of the transaction.
  • Provide details of the payment transactions, including amounts and any necessary references.
  • Double-check all entries for accuracy.
  • Remember to submit the form prior to the deadline of 2:45 P.M. Central Time to ensure same-day processing.
